Job Description

About CCBS

Child Communication and Behavior Specialists (CCBS) is a clinician-owned ABA agency dedicated to ensuring client progress through exceptional mentorship and support for RBTs and Master's level practitioners. We emphasize naturalistic teaching and foster a person-centered, neurodiversity-affirming, and culturally inclusive environment.

The Position

We are seeking a Hybrid BCBA Supervisor & Clinical Consultant to join our team. This role offers 50–75% remote opportunities, with in-person sessions conducted in clinics or client homes.

As a BCBA Supervisor, you'll:

  • Deliver impactful caregiver-mediated treatment (CMT).
  • Oversee engaging social skills groups.
  • Support and supervise RBTs and student analysts, helping them thrive professionally.
  • Collaborate with a dynamic team to implement individualized, high-quality ABA programs.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ide hands-on clinical supervision using Behavioral Skills Training (BST).
  • Facilitate caregiver training to foster active participation and successful client outcomes.
  • Ensure at least 90% utilization of recommended treatment hours.
  • Deliver a minimum of 30 clinical hours per week.
  • Work in diverse settings, including clinics, homes, and telehealth, to meet client needs.
  • Collaborate to meet organizational KPIs and drive program excellence through meeting deadlines and following company policies.
  • Monitor treatment progress and maintain detailed, timely documentation.

The Successful Candidate

  • Holds a valid BCBA certification.
  • Has 2+ years of supervisory experience.
  • Demonstrates excellent time management, flexibility, and teamwork skills.
  • Excels in caregiver training, social skills facilitation, and BST methods.
  • Communicates effectively and adapts to different learning styles.
  • Committed to ongoing professional development and evidence-based practices.
  • Passes a background check, has a valid driver's license, and reliable transportation.

Compensation and Benefits

  • Base Salary Range : $80,000–$90,000 annually.
  • Bonuses : Quarterly and annual performance incentives, including:
    • Team Performance Bonuses : Up to $375 quarterly per individual for achieving team KPIs.
    • Individual Bonuses : Additional $3/hour for exceeding billable targets.
    • Exceptional Performance Bonuses : Up to $250 per quarter for exceeding all metrics.
    • Annual Recognition Bonus : $500 for consistent KPI achievement.
  • Additional Benefits :
    • $450 yearly CEU stipend.
    • In-house CEUs as a participant or presenter.
    • Company cell phone and laptop.
    •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ance.
    • 401k retirement plan.
